> Description
> -------
>
> First phase: Mesos-slave support for "node drain"
>
> This phase handles the shutdown of the slave, triggered by SIGUSR1 signal:
> * implement a signal handler which is invoked when SIGUSR1 signal is issued
> * the signal handler will dispatch the 'shutdown' method of the Slave class, which shuts down all the frameworks and executors that run on the slave.
>
> In the next phase, the slave will send an unregistration request to the master in order to overcome the lag of the health check timer (75 sec).
